Japan in the Age of Inequality! The richest 3% own 26% of the country's wealth

Summary by Bani.md
Japan's wealthiest now hold assets worth a total of 469,000 billion yen (about $3.100 billion), according to a report by the Nomura Research Institute (NRI), cited by Bloomberg. This is a significant increase compared to the much slower pace at which the assets of most Japanese citizens have grown.
